Natural Wanders’ Franschhoek Wine Walk is a leisurely, immersive experience that blends wine, nature, and storytelling. Here’s what to expect:

Scenic Route & Farms

This guided 4 km walking tour begins at the Dutch Reformed Church in Franschhoek before slipping seamlessly into vineyards, orchards, and refined gardens. You'll visit three celebrated estates along the way:

  • Mont Rochelle
  • Mullineux & Leeu

Wine Tastings & Culinary Finale

Enjoy nine curated wine tastings paired with local snacks throughout the tour. Your walk concludes with a harvest-style lunch served al fresco at La Cotte Heritage Farm—sat down amidst the vine-clad vistas.

Storytelling & Local Colour

The walk is as much about wine as it is about the region’s soul. Expect captivating stories—from Huguenot heritage to local legends, including jousting stick mishaps and Franschhoek’s first non-white mayor.

Tour Essentials

  • Duration: Approximately 6 hours (typically 08:30–14:30)
  • Meeting Point: Dutch Reformed Church, Franschhoek
  • Walking Distance: Under 4 km—suitable for most fitness levels
  • Cost: R1,950 per person (includes wine tastings, snacks, lunch, guide)
  • Private tours and individual bookings can be arranged on request
  • What to Bring: Comfortable shoes, sun hat, sunscreen, camera, and water (provided at stops)
